Some thought that Disney could “let it go” and leave “Frozen” behind with its beautiful animation, powerful storyline and clever music; but, of course, they’re doing a sequel. The “Frozen 2” teaser trailer was released on February 13 and fans are wondering what the plot is going to be. There are multiple theories going around but no one is quite sure. All that we know is what IMDb lists as the storyline. They write “Anna, Elsa, Kristoff and Olaf are going far in the forest to learn the truth about an ancient mystery of their kingdom.”

The teaser trailer starts off with Elsa battling the ocean and trying to walk on the water as waves crash around her. This is the typical Elsa everyone knows and loves, the strong, determined and ambitious ice queen. Just like the first movie, she is alone and isolated. It seems as if she is trying to escape.

After the words This Fall appears, the viewer is taken back to Arendelle, where Anna looks out from her balcony to see multiple ice crystal symbols shining on the palace. This makes the viewer really question what is happening. Is something invading the kingdom of Arendelle? Are there more people with powers like Elsa? What do these symbols mean – are they evil or good?

Over a familiar score from the first film, the beloved characters return including Kristoff, Sven, and Olaf. Anna and Elsa seem to have similar but new styles that make them stand out and look more fierce than the first movie.

The trailer also seems to highlight different nature elements such as water, wind, and fire. The different seasons also seem to be present, especially autumn, with leaves falling and the trees turning colors.

Based on all this information, it seems like “Frozen 2” will take a look into other elements and seasons. Disney has already produced shorts based in the winter and spring, so it is only natural to place this film during the fall.

This film could explore other people with similar powers as Elsa, perhaps those who control other elements such as fire, wind and water. Could the ancient mystery of the kingdom be based on what gave Elsa her powers? Could it explain why the boat that Anna and Elsa’s parents were on went crashing in the waves and they were lost at sea? Or could the famous Hans and his 12 brothers make an appearance to take over the kingdom of Arendelle? Only time will tell.

All I know for sure is that “Frozen 2” has to live up to some major expectations. Just from the trailer, the animation is even more impressive than the first movie. The storyline seems like an action packed and fierce take on a beloved classic. Hopefully, there will be even more original, catchy music that will get people singing and wanting more. A new cast of characters I’m sure is in the works but I hope that they do not overpower those familiar characters we all know and love.

Besides what we can see and predict based on the teaser trailer, there have been a lot of people calling for Elsa to have a female love interest, which would make her the first gay character in a Disney movie. There are many mixed emotions about that proposed script write in. So, the only way to find out what Disney does with that theory is for people to flock to the theaters to find out.

“Frozen 2” will be released just before Thanksgiving on November 22, 2019.
